The Monticello Magic will head out on the road to challenge the Princeton Tigers at 4:30 p.m. on Tuesday. Monticello is coming into the matchup hot, having won their last five games.
On Friday, Monticello beat Benilde-St. Margaret's 5-2.
Monticello saw five different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Brock Holthaus, who went 1-for-4 with one stolen base, one run, and one RBI.
Meanwhile, it was a proper cat-fight when Princeton duked it out with Chisago Lakes Area on Monday. The Tigers were the clear victors by a 9-0 margin over the Wildcats. The Tigers haven't had any issues with the Wildcats recently, as the game was their sixth consecutive win against them.
Monticello's victory was their seventh straight at home, which pushed their record up to 8-2. Those home wins came thanks in part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as they averaged 9.6 runs over those games. As for Princeton, their victory bumped their record up to 6-4.
Monticello was able to grind out a solid win over Princeton when the teams last played back in April, winning 4-0. The rematch might be a little tougher for the Magic since the squad won't have the home-field adv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
